GSGW Spoiler (part 2)
Kim Soleum can not perceive anyone's face when he is 130666. I don't think there was a specific reason stated but I believe it is because he is more author than character in that moment.
Kim Soleum is always a bit different during the novel since he is not from that world and counts as ireum-nim.
For example he is the only one that can see Lee Jaheons true appearance. This could be because the world does not have to hide any truths from him and he is technically a creator.
People from the DER world go insane when they learn the truth of the world. However Kim Soleum is obviously unaffected and has been aware since the beginning.
Another possibility might be that even if any kind of knowledge (not specifically the truth but smth else) would cause him to enter a state of madness it would simply be passed of to his real body like a one sided game of hot potato.
So back to the topic Kim Soleum is not a character in the DER wiki. Instead he is a author and I think that when he is in his 130666 state he is closer to being a author than character. or ireum-nim if you want to refer to him as such.
There is a fourth wall separating fiction from reality. Therefore Kim Soleum would be in a kind of limbo by interacting with the 'fiction' while still counting as being from 'reality'.
That separation could manifest as him not being able to perceive faces.
Additionaly, he can delete and rewrite as 130666 which are obviously traits that count as being an author. Though he loses his humanity when he uses that ability. His apperance and stability is closly connected to him humanity.
So his 130666 state is basically 'ireum-nim'.
However I also think that since the DER world relies on how other percieve certain things that those affect Kim Soleum too.
Ghost stories can be created per rumours as we have seen previously with that red shirt ghost story. Therfore if Kim Soleum counts as a darkness because he is a good friend, contaminated by the music box and ireum-nim those rules could techniacly apply to him too.
We don't know how far this 'believe' system goes since we have only seen it create and destroy ghost stories but I don't think it is far fetched to say it could manipulated them to a certain extend as long as the original rules of the ghost story are not affected since that is something only a author can change.
Going back we can apply the perception to Kim Soleum in the sense that ireum-nim has already been established in the DER world before he entered it. Ireum-nim is a concept/ghost story that has existed for a longer time in the wiki and therefore as established rules and believes in the DER world.
One believe is that ireum-nim is not human but rather a higher being/god. Thus, ireum-nim would not look, act or feel like a human would. This could affect Kim Soleum in the sense that acting as a author brings him closer to being ireum-nim and therefor those rules and believes.

GSGW spoiler (part 2)
Ghost stories operate under certain rules and one of kim soleums seems to be going home as his wish.
We know that he collapsed into 130666 after finding out that he is not human.
He found out that he isn't technically human but he also started to believe that he can't go home. The wish ticket didn't work and that was his only known way at the time to return.
No phrasing would have guaranteed him going back. Additionally if he isn't human how could he possibly go to his friends and family?
When he started to regain his humanity he also started to believe that there is a new chance of him going home. Specifically stating that he would try again and being more desperate than before.
The cheerful reserach institute also wrote that in order for the entity, that they would summon, to be stable certain conditions had to be met. One of those was a goal I believe.
So a lack of a goal would cause Kim Soleum to collapse therefore he can't excist without the wish to go home.
This would add to the desperation he was feeling and his actions even if only unconsciously.
However would this mean that he could collapse in the real world? There is no goal of going home but also no ghost stories. So we can't know for sure if ghost story rules still apply or Kim Soleum still has to stabilise himself in someway or from.
